Intercom Changes Name to Fin

In a surprising move, Intercom has announced that it is changing its name to Fin. This change is part of the company’s efforts to expand its services and reach a wider audience. Meta Won’t Let You Block its AI Account on Threads

In other news, Meta has announced that it won’t allow users to block its AI account on Threads. This move has raised some concerns among users, who are worried about the potential impact on their online experience. For more information on this topic, you can visit the Meta website.
